Output 43f56ec88e4bfbb58b503a38d1ed56f7a69461000f7b24d2e576192752876910:6

value
894115879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e919ccbb198813068ba39871a89789b202c13f2a OP_EQUALVERIFY OP_CHECKSIG
address
1NFXMJ19pEcxUvFb49oKMkhNVwumybbbhS
transaction
43f56ec88e4bfbb58b503a38d1ed56f7a69461000f7b24d2e576192752876910
spent
true